How Unipol positions itself
Unipol Gruppo S.p.A. is one of Italy's largest insurance and banking groups, combining non-life and life insurance with banking services through its subsidiary UnipolSai and Unipol Banca. The group focuses on domestic customers, with a substantial presence in motor, property, and health coverage.
The company pursues a multi-channel strategy, using agents, branches, and bancassurance agreements with cooperative banks such as BPER Banca to reach retail and SME clients. This integrated model is designed to generate recurring fee and premium income across economic cycles.
Where peers stand in Europe
In the broader European insurance landscape, peers like Assicurazioni Generali and Allianz report sizable premium volumes and diversified business lines, underlining the scale of the sector. Generali, for example, posted gross written premiums above 82 billion euros in recent years, reflecting its pan-European reach.
Allianz, a member of the DAX index in Frankfurt, combines property-casualty, life, and asset management operations, with assets under management in the trillion-euro range according to company disclosures. These benchmarks help investors gauge Unipol's relative size and focus within continental insurance markets.
How the money is made
Unipol derives most of its revenue from non-life insurance, particularly motor and property policies sold under brands such as UnipolSai. Life insurance products, including savings and protection policies, complement this core, while banking services provide interest and fee income.
